Flycut
I've Searched this forum with no luck, Read my instructions and hooked up my tach to the designated CDI wiring, Still no working tach. I know my tach is good because I can easily hook up my stock ignition and when I go to the negative coil it works fine. Anyone have a solution that does not require me to buy the tach adapter. confused24.gif
Aaron Cox
i did a writeup on this...

how to get your STOCK tach to work with a CDI ignition box without an adpater....

thought process:
What wire from the dizzy gives the box the trigger signal? (mallory unilite is green/white/red right?)

i *think* the trigger wire is the greeb one off of the unilite (going from memory)...

guess what the green wire is? a signal to the box to fire! and you guessed it.. if you splice/tee into that connection to the box, your tach will work fine!

i got mine to work with the Tach signal off the box too (internal mods to tach) if you are intersted in that too.

its really that simple. you can tap into the trigger wire from the dizzy to the box, or you can buy a tach adapter and run it off the tach circuit of the box, or you can internally modify your tach (search tach mod written by AGRUMP)
